Eat Right, Stay Healthy – Part 1

Key Verse

“And God said, Behold, I have given you every herb bearing seed, which is upon the face of all the earth, and every tree, in the which is the fruit of a tree yielding seed; to you it shall be for meat.” Genesis 1:29

Text — Genesis 1:27-31

Message

Eddy likes to eat a lot. It appears he’s always chewing something anytime you see him. From the time he wakes up, as soon as he brushes his teeth, he has something to chew. He likes to chew bubble gum, eat candy, chocolate, cookies, doughnuts, cakes, pies and all sorts of sugar-filled drinks most of the time. Although his mum cooks vegetables and makes fruits available both at home and in his lunch box for school, Eddy always makes excuses for not eating them. It was not a surprise therefore when he started complaining of serious tummy ache and eventually had to be admitted in the hospital. The doctor told him he had to eat right to be healthy. He was told to do away with junks and eat balanced diet for a healthy lifestyle.


As it is necessary to eat right to stay physically fit, so does God want us to be spiritually strong. To be spiritually healthy, you need to read your Bible and pray every day. Avoid bad company and habits like keeping malice, fighting, watching ungodly movies or cartoons, playing unproductive games etc. God wants us to be in health but we also have a role to play. Avoid junks, eat healthy!

About Author - Pastor W.F. Kumuyi

Listed among “500 most powerful people on the planet” by the Foreign Policy magazine in 2013, Pastor (Dr.) William F. Kumuyi is the founder and General Superintendent of the Deeper Christian Life Ministry (DCLM) headquartered in Lagos, Nigeria. DCLM started in 1973 as a 15-member Bible study group right in Kumuyi’s apartment at University of Lagos where he was a lecturer. His revolutionary Bible teaching on personal holiness and commitment to evangelism soon gained so much traction and resulted in a widespread revival.
